Re: Buying a Probe GT (KLZE). Good Deal or Bad Deal?
EGR is there to reduce the NOX by circulating some exhaust back into the combusion chamber, if you don't hook it up your NOX will be high. On the ZE there's no hole into the cyls for the exhaust to go. I hooked mine up so I wouldn't get a code. Go to your DMV and ask if they have a HotRod status for custom cars.
